Understanding the Role of Steroids in Team Sports
Steroids function by mimicking the effects of testosterone, leading to enhanced protein synthesis and increased muscle mass. In team sports, where physical prowess and agility are crucial, athletes may resort to steroids for a variety of reasons, including:
- Improved Strength: Steroids can significantly boost an athlete’s strength, allowing them to perform better in their sport.
- Enhanced Recovery: Many athletes report quicker recovery times from injuries and intense workouts, enabling them to train harder and more frequently.
- Increased Endurance: Some steroids can improve stamina, which is vital in endurance-based team sports.
